A/B Testing — Why and What

Every company is different and hence every company has a unique set of customers. There’s no one size fits all approach to winning over customers.

Actually, the definition of an optimal website and effective product changes from organization to organization.

To comprehend what would be the best website design or the most utilitarian product feature, you must first understand your customers and their preferences.

While A/B Testing does sound like a very heavy exercise and as a complicated tool in itself, the reality is that it is a simple experiment.

It involves random testing of two or more variants of a page by users. These tests are then analyzed and the statistics are used to determine which page was better received by the user in terms of conversion.

#1: Google Analytics and Google Optimize

Google Analytics helps you understand the pattern in which your users are engaging with your content.

This understanding helps you develop a deep insight into what’s working for you and what is not.

The tool also helps you analyze how people are interacting with your social media sites through a well-presented dashboard and insightful reports.

You can even connect your in-house systems for a more detailed understanding of customer behavior and dynamics.

While the tool is free, large organizations usually prefer to sign up for the Google Analytics 360 suite.

However, the only downside to using the Google Analytics tool is the complexity of the tool. You would need to be well versed with the platform and be technically sound.

Only then would you be able to achieve the desired results by using this tool.

So if you enjoy tech, this tool offers all the features you would surely be interested in.

#3: VWO

In terms of features, is very similar to Optimizely’s yet is one of its biggest competitors.

The A/B Testing tool in VWO allows you to create and run tests that help increase revenue, curb cart abandonment instances, all the while allowing you to build stellar digital experiences for your customers throughout their shopping experience.

And all this, without any experience in coding or need of employing a tech-savvy person to your team.

Besides, VWO has a dedicated mobile testing tool that allows you to get feedback from users.

VWO also offers you the feature of combining sessions and converting them into heat maps to better analyze the reasons for a lower conversion rate.

The platform not only manages email marketing but also targets customers across social media channels through automated marketing campaigns and web push notifications.

All in all, a complete solution to improve those key business metrics and engagement.
